EconomyFed raises rates for first time since 2023 in unanimous vote defying Trump

The Federal Reserve lifted its benchmark interest rate by a quarter point to 3.75%-4%, marking its first increase since July 2023. The unanimous 12-0 decision puts Chair Kevin Warsh directly at odds with US President Donald Trump, who appointed him.
